Comprehensive Guide to Door Repairs: Understanding the Process, Costs, and Techniques
Doors are necessary parts of every home and company, supplying security, privacy, and aesthetic appeals. Nevertheless, wear and tear can cause different issues, demanding door repairs. This article explores common door issues, repair strategies, associated expenses, and frequently asked concerns about door repairs.
Types of Door Repairs
Doors can experience a series of problems depending upon their type, material, and usage. Some of the most typical types of door repairs include:
Hinge Repairs:
Loose hinges causing doors to droop.Rusty hinges that requirement replacement or lubrication.
Door Frames:
Damaged or deformed frames from weather condition direct exposure.Fractures or splits in the frame.
Locks and Latches:
Broken locks that require replacement.Misaligned latches preventing correct closure.
Surface area Damage:
Scratches, damages, and holes in wooden or metal doors.Faded paint or surface needing repainting or refinishing.
Weather condition Stripping:
Worn out or harmed weather stripping permitting drafts or wetness.Step-by-Step Guide to Common Door Repairs
Below are numerous common door repair techniques, laying out actions and needed products.
Repairing a Sagging Door
A drooping door can be an annoyance, often caused by loose hinges or a warped frame.
Materials Needed:
ScrewdriverWood shimLevel
Steps:
Check Hinge Screws: Inspect the hinge screws for tightness. If they are loose, tighten them utilizing a screwdriver.Utilize a Level: Place a level against the door to see how far it is sagging.Insert Shims: If the door is drooping considerably, insert a wood shim behind the leading hinge. This can assist raise the door back into place.Re-tighten Screws: After adjusting the shim, re-tighten the hinge screws. Test the door and make additional changes if necessary.Repairing a Sticky Door
A sticky door can be brought on by humidity, temperature changes, or misalignment.
Materials Needed:
Sandpaper or a hand aircraftScrewdriver
Actions:
Inspect for Rubbing: Close the door and check which areas are rubbing versus the frame.Get Rid Of Door if Necessary: If considerable change is required, get rid of the door using a screwdriver.Sand the Rubbing Areas: Use sandpaper or a hand plane to shave down the locations that are sticking. Be client and test regularly.Rehang and Adjust: Rehang the door and make any final adjustments.Changing a Door Lock
A malfunctioning lock can posture security threats and trouble.
Materials Needed:
New lock setScrewdriverDetermining tape
Actions:
Remove the Old Lock: Unscrew the existing lockset from both the interior and exterior sides of the door.Measure and Prepare: Measure the door's thickness and the existing holes to ensure a proper suitable for the new lock.Set Up the New Lock: Follow the manufacturer's instructions to install the brand-new lock, guaranteeing it's properly lined up and safely attached.Check the Lock: Test the lock to guarantee it operates efficiently.Repainting or Refinishing a Door
Doors can begin to look worn with time, needing a fresh coat of paint or stain.
Products Needed:
Paint or stainGuide (if painting)Paintbrush or rollerSandpaperTidy fabric
Steps:
Remove Hardware: Take off doorknobs and other hardware to make painting simpler.Sand the Surface: Lightly sand the door to get rid of old paint or stain and develop a smooth surface for adhesion.Tidy the Door: Wipe the door with a clean fabric to get rid of dust and debris.Apply Primer: If painting, use a coat of guide.Paint or Stain: Apply the picked paint or stain with even strokes, allowing each coat to dry thoroughly before including additional coats.Cost Involved in Door Repairs
The cost of door repairs can differ significantly based upon the type of repair needed and your geographic area. Below is a general overview of anticipated costs:
Repair TypeApproximated Cost RangeHinge repairs₤ 10 - ₤ 50Frame repair₤ 50 - ₤ 200Lock replacement₤ 30 - ₤ 150Surface area refinishing₤ 50 - ₤ 300Weather condition stripping₤ 10 - ₤ 50
Note: The costs might exclude any prospective labor charges if employing a professional.
Often Asked Questions About Door Repairs1. How do I know if my door needs repair?
Indications of damage, trouble in opening or closing, and visible wear and tear are indications that your door may require repair.
2. Can I repair my door myself, or should I hire a professional?
Many little repairs can be done by house owners with basic tools. However, for intricate issues, or if you lack the needed abilities, it might be smart to employ a professional.
3. How frequently should I check my doors?
Routine assessments (a minimum of once a year) are advised to guarantee that doors remain in excellent condition. Try to find indications of damage and deal with any problems quickly.
4. What products are best for door repairs?
For wooden doors, wood glue and wood filler are perfect, while metal doors may need a metal patching compound. Constantly utilize weather-resistant materials for outdoor doors.
5. Can a warped door be repaired?
In a lot of cases, a distorted door can be repaired by realigning or changing the hinges or by using wetness and heat to restore the initial shape. Nevertheless, severe warping may require door replacement.
